Sodium Cyanide: The Gold Mining Extraction Standard
Sodium substance cyanid has become the principal process for recovering precious metal from stone in modern mining. This approach involves leaching finely pulverized ore in a cyanid solution, permitting the precious cyanide process for gold metal to go into solution. While alternative techniques are available, sodium cyanid’s effectiveness and affordability have largely established it as the industry practice.

NaCN in Gold Mining : Functionality and Market Value
Sodium cyanide plays a critical function in modern gold mining operations . It's largely utilized as a substance in the cyanide process , a process that efficiently recovers metals from rock . The system involves combining finely milled material with a cyanide solution in the availability of oxygen . This forms a mixture that allows the gold to become soluble. Gold Extraction Efficiency and Sodium Cyanide Price Trends
The relationship between gold winning efficiency and the value of sodium cyanide is becoming increasingly critical. Historically, improved mining processes, particularly utilizing finer crushing sizes and optimized air regimes, have decreased the volume of cyanide needed per ton of rock, thereby lessening the impact of cyanide value fluctuations. However, recent spikes in sodium cyanide cost, driven by production chain issues and increased necessity from other industries, are now creating a challenge to miners. Finally, companies are required to either acknowledge higher operational expenditures or allocate in processes that further enhance gold mining efficiency to counteract these growing cyanide cost pressures. Secure Management and Costing of Na- Cyanide for Extraction
Proper processing of sodium cyanide in recovery operations is of highest importance, demanding strict safety protocols . Careful instruction for personnel is necessary to avoid accidents and environmental destruction. Valuing sodium cyanide incorporates its risky nature, delivery costs , and legal adherence stipulations , often resulting in a considerable charge compared to safer- chemicals . Secure warehousing and removal methods are also necessary aspects impacting the overall expense.
